Staff, artifact (requires attunement by a sorcerer, warlock, or wizard)

This crooked staff is carved from wood and bathed in gold, topped with 7 elemental jewels. The staff was designed through the laborious crafting of a guild of ancient adventurers and was kept safe in their tomb. When touched, the skull expels dark green gas.

Beneficial Properties. While the staff is on your person, you gain the following benefits:

  • You can choose to know 7 additional spells of your choice from the sorcerer, warlock, or wizard spell lists. The spells must be of a level for which you have spell slots.
  • As a bonus action, every undead creature you choose that you can see gains 20 temporary hit points. An undead can only benefit from this effect once every 24 hours.
  • You can wield the staff as a +3 quarterstaff that deals an extra 10 (3d6) necrotic damage on a hit.

Guild Possession. The Guildmaster's Staff can only be attuned to if its previous owner dies or willingly unattunes to this item. creatures not attuned to the staff that willingly touch it are targeted by a random spell detailed below (spell save DC 27, +19 to hit with spell attacks). Spells cast by the staff don't require concentration and last their full duration.

D8 EFFECT
1 The staff casts shatter as a 5th level spell centered on you.
2 The staff casts lightning bolt as a 5th level spell.
3 The staff casts melf's acid arrow as a 5th level spell.
4 The staff casts scorching ray as a 5th level spell.
5 The staff casts mind spike as a 5th level spell. The creature attuned to the staff learns their location.
6 The staff casts conjure elemental. The summoned elemental is immediately hostile and attacks any creature not attuned to the staff.
7 The staff casts cloudkill centered on itself.
8 Re-roll on this table

 

Spell Mastery. The Guildmaster's Staff has 7 charges and regains 1d4 + 3 expended charges daily at dawn. While holding the staff, you can expend 1 + spell slot level charges to cast one of your spells without expending a spell slot.

Destroying the Staff. The staff can only be destroyed if all of the creatures that have ever attuned to it are dead.
